The chronicled history of Freemasonry begins with the formation of the first Grand Lodge in London in 1717, though its philosophical foundations and some of its practices date back much further. Research suggests that Freemasonry grew from the guilds of stonemasons who created Europe’s magnificent cathedrals during the Middle Ages. These practicing masons gradually began accepting “accepted” or “speculative” members who were not craftsmen but were attracted to the moral and philosophical aspects of the craft. In England, Freemasonry advanced under the supervision of the United Grand Lodge of England (UGLE), which persists as the home grand lodge for many Masonic jurisdictions worldwide. The structured system of degrees, officers, and ceremonies that marks modern Freemasonry largely took shape during the 18th century, though it has undergone various reforms and adaptations over time. The three principal degrees, Entered Apprentice, Fellow Craft, and Master Mason, each deliver different lessons about personal growth and ethical living. The Entered Apprentice degree focuses on foundational knowledge and basic moral principles. The Fellow Craft degree centers on the application of knowledge and the liberal arts and sciences. Finally, the Master Mason degree delves into profound existential themes related to mortality and rebirth.
